Footwear Safety in the Light of Scientific Research

Jacek Przepiórka,
Marian Szczerek

Abstract: Improving living conditions and developing medical care contributes to increasing human life expectancy.Because motor skills decrease with age, older people need comfortable shoes that provide a high level ofsafety. The soles should not deform during temperature changes, they should have appropriate thermalinsulation properties and a good grip to dry, wet, and dirty floor surfaces, as slips usually occur on surfacescovered with ice, water, oil, grease, mud, etc.During the use of footwear, the friction coeffici… Show more
